Summary |
Discussing the work of more than 60 poets from the US, UK, Ireland, Australia, New Zealand and the Caribbean, Nerys Williams guides students through the key ideas and movements in the study of poetry today. |
Contents |
Introduction -- Lyric subjects -- Politics and poetics -- Performance and the poem -- Environment and space -- Dialects, idiolects and multilingual poetries -- Conclusion. |
